On-line file system correction within a clustered processing sys

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

39518203, G06F 1700

Patent

active

057272069

ABSTRACT:
A method for identifying and repairing file system damage following the failure of a processing node within a clustered UNIX file system including a plurality of processing nodes, an interconnection network connecting the processing nodes, and a data storage device connected via a shared interconnect with each one of the plurality of processing nodes. The method includes the step of maintaining a journal for each processing node, each journal containing a bit map identifying inodes to which its associated processing node has acquired and retains an exclusive right. Each bit map journal is updated whenever its associated processing node acquires an exclusive right to an inode. Following a failure of a processing node, a non-failed processing node is designated to audit the inodes associated with the failed node. Auditing is accomplished by reading the bit map journal associated with the failed processing node and obtaining the exclusive right to every inode found within the journal. The inodes within the bit map journal, referred to as suspect inodes, are then compared with a global bit map which identifies each and every unit of space within the file system that is assignable. A suspect node is identified as having a transient state when the unit of space assigned to the suspect inode is also found to be assignable. The assignment of a unit of file system space to any suspect inode identified as having a transient state is thereafter discarded.

REFERENCES:
patent: 5151988 (1992-09-01), Yamagishi
patent: 5175852 (1992-12-01), Johnson et al.
patent: 5202971 (1993-04-01), Henson et al.
patent: 5218695 (1993-06-01), Novelk et al.
patent: 5293618 (1994-03-01), Tandai et al.
patent: 5301290 (1994-04-01), Tetzlaff et al.
patent: 5317749 (1994-05-01), Dahlen
patent: 5339427 (1994-08-01), Elko et al.
patent: 5371885 (1994-12-01), Letwin
patent: 5394551 (1995-02-01), Holt et al.
patent: 5423044 (1995-06-01), Sutton et al.
patent: 5463772 (1995-10-01), Thompson et al.
patent: 5504883 (1996-04-01), Coverston et al.
patent: 5564011 (1996-10-01), Yammine et al.
patent: 5612865 (1997-03-01), Dasgupta
patent: 5623651 (1997-04-01), Jernigan, IV
Mark Aldred et al., "A Distributed Lock Manager on Fault Tolerant MPP," Proceedings of the 28th Annual Hawaii International Conference on System Sciences, IEEE 1995, pp. 134-136 No month.
Werner Zurcher, "The State of Clustered Systems," UNIX Review, vol. 13, No. 9, Aug. 1995, pp.47-51.
Shinjj Sumimoto, "Design and Evaluation of Fault-Tolerant Shared File System for Cluster Systems," 1996 Int'l Symposium on Fault-Tolerant Computing (FTCS 26), 1996, pp. 74-83 No month.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

On-line file system correction within a clustered processing sys does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with On-line file system correction within a clustered processing sys,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and On-line file system correction within a clustered processing sys will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-149768

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.